Barcelona are reportedly convinced they have all but wrapped up a summer transfer deal for Ilkay Gundogan.

As things stand, the Manchester City captain is set to see his current contract with the Citizens expire at the end of this month.

With the 32-year-old set to lead his side out in tomorrow’s FA Cup final and next weekend’s Champions League final, it has been claimed that these could well be his final games for the club.

Barcelona closing in on Gundogan deal

According to a recent report from Sport, Barcelona have persuaded Gundogan to put pen to paper on a three-year deal with the Spanish club.

The report also adds that despite City’s efforts of getting the midfielder to sign a new deal at the Etihad, Xavi has played a big part in seeing Barcelona make their offer to the player.

City signed the midfielder back in 2016 from Borussia Dortmund in a deal worth a reported fee of £20m.

Since then, Gundogan has gone on to make 302 appearances for Pep Guardiola’s side across all competitions, scoring 58 goals and delivering 40 assists in the process.

Having featured in 31 of City’s 38 Premier League games this season, as well as starting 11 of their 12 Champions League matches, this highlights how important the veteran has been for the team.

In fact, with Guardiola sharing his hopes of seeing Gundogan sign a new deal and continuing his journey with the Citizens, this latest report will not be good news for the manager.

Although, with the club reportedly in talks over a potential summer move for Mateo Kovacic, this could be in case their current midfielder leaves the Etihad.
